Giovinazzi: My fight will get me to Ferrari

Antonio Giovinazzi has said the fight he has shown in overcoming difficulties in his short Formula 1 career will show that he is worthy of a future Ferrari spot. Giovinazzi was Ferrari's third driver in 2017 after finishing runner-up in GP2 the previous year and was called up to Sauber for the first two races of 2017 to substitute for the injured Pascal Wehrlein. Article continues under video After a fine debut in Australia, Giovinazzi crashed twice during the weekend in China, but he believes the way he has fought back since shows he has what it takes to get a top drive.
